Subject: BLKSIZE=10

Hello,

I have a programmer who insists the following JCL has always calculated a
valid blksize:

//SYSUT2   DD  DSN=DAPJPQ.TEST.NEW,
//         DISP=(NEW,CATLG,DELETE),SPACE=(TRK,(22430,0)),
//         DCB=(C.SYUNIV.MODEL,RECFM=U,LRECL=6184),
//         UNIT=SYSDA

Now (since Friday he says)  this JCL is calculating a blksize of 10 and of
course the resulting dataset is not usable.  I have CA:Allocate here, and I
tried the JCL without Allocate and it still gets a blksize of 0 - so
Allocate is not involved.

Has anybody else had this issue?
